在 Tik Tok 与 Immutable 的合作博客文章中,Tik Tok 特别提到了 StarkWare 是第一个碳中和的 L2 拓展解决方案。 在传统互联网公司的视角里,环保是很重要的,不环保是很容易受到抨击的,因此 L2 高性能和节约资源的特性也能吸引传统互联网公司的目光,给他们铺平道路,光明正大入局加密货币领域。 StarkWare 提供给 Immutable 的解决方案最终让 Tik Tok 这个目前最热门的公司找上了 Immutable 进行合作。 StarkWare 所提供的两种部署模式给了客户数据保存方式的灵活性,不仅符合法规,同时也让性能得以拓展。更重要的是,性能的拓展也让以太坊饱受争议的能耗问题得到了解决,这会是 Layer 2 的胜利,更是 StarkWare 的胜利。在未来,我们一定会看到更多的传统企业选择以太坊以及 StarkWare 的方式进入区块链领域。 StarkWare 应用为何有如此高的性能?StarkWare 的 Prover 有各种数学优化和 StarkWare 首先提出的一些优化算法,同时开发所用的 Cairo 语言有专门数学相关的优化。除此之外交互数据送到 Prover 之前会用 StarkEx 引擎先协调一遍待证明的数据以及批处理。 整个运行流程都做到了全覆盖的优化。 具体细节会在后文中详细探讨。 StarkWare 应用的去中心化程度?StarkWare 的 StarkNet 上的共识为 zk-STARK. zk-Rollups 不一定是去中心化,无准入限制的。 但是 StarkWare 所使用的 zk-STARK 是无准入限制的,与以太坊等公链一样。 在 StarkWare 所做的应用中间过程是会存在一些中心化的服务器来提供一些服务。 但这在一个完整应用的开发中是必要且无法去除的。 就像 uniswap 必须得有个中心化的域名和前端一样。 所以 StarkWare 所做的 dYdX, StarkNet 等依然是去中心化的。 zkSync 和 StarkWare 对比目前来看,StarkWare 无论是从性能还是目前的运行状况,都领先于 zkSync。zkSync 和 StarkWare 最大的区别还是运作理念。 zkSync 的项目都是开源的,而且团队说自己被替代掉也无所谓,只要能推动社区和以太坊的发展。 StarkWare 公司是 TOB 中心化的运作方式,STARK 证明器目前只能 StarkWare 公司使用,而且做 Cairo 这个语言其实也是不那么对以太坊生态有利的做法 (对开发者友好的做法应该是和 zkSync 或 Optimistic 一样去做 EVM 兼容)。 zk-Rollups 与 STARK 证明
|